Determination of power losses in high-voltage direct current (HVDC) converter stations with line-com...
IEC 61803:1999+A1:2010 applies to all line-commutated high-voltage direct current (HVDC) converter stations used for power exchange in utility systems. This standard presumes the use of 12-pulse thyristor converters but can, with due care, also be used for 6-pulse thyristor converters. Boxes and enclosures for electrical accessories for household and similar fixed electrical installat...
IEC 60670-24:2011 applies to enclosures and parts of them for housing protective devices and other power dissipating electrical equipment intended to be used with a rated voltage not exceeding 400 V and a total incoming load current not exceeding 125 A for household and similar fixed electrical installations. Road vehicles — Tachograph systems — Part 2: Electrical interface with recording unit
ISO 16844-2:2011 specifies the electrical connection between the recording unit, and the vehicle network and the motion sensor, in tachograph systems used in road vehicles.
Medical electrical equipment - Part 2-49: Particular requirements for the basic safety and essential...
IEC 60601-2-49:2011 applies to the basic safety and essential performance requirements of multifunction patient monitoring equipment. It applies to medical electrical equipment used in a hospital environment as well as when used outside the hospital environment, such as in ambulances and air transport.
